Chemosensory genes in the head of Spodoptera litura larvae

Lu-Lu Li et al.

Summary: The study identified 158 putative chemosensory genes in S. litura based on transcriptomic and genomic data, including OBPs, CSPs, ORs, and GRs. Nine highly expressed genes in the heads of 3-5-day-old larvae are potential key players in the chemosensory system. These findings significantly expand the gene inventory for S. litura and provide potential target genes for further research on larval feeding behavior.

Coordinative mediation of the response to alarm pheromones by three odorant binding proteins in the green peach aphid Myzus persicae

Qian Wang et al.

Summary: The study showed that the simultaneous knockdown of MperOBP3/7/9 expression significantly reduced the electrophysiological response and the repellent behaviours of green peach aphids to (E)-β-farnesene. Competitive binding assays revealed that the mixture of MperOBP3, MperOBP7, MperOBP9, and MperOBP3/7/9 exhibited a stronger binding affinity for (E)-β-farnesene than for other compounds. This interaction between OBPs may facilitate the delivery of (E)-β-farnesene during insect odorant signal transduction, mediating the response of green peach aphids to the alarm pheromone.
